线程的概念
线程是程序执行的最小单位,也是操作系统调度和分配CPU的最小单位,是进程中的一个实体,是进程中实际运行的单位。可以在进程中启动多个线程来完成不同的任务,这些线程共享该进程拥有的资源。
线程与进程的区别
进程是程序的实体,也是线程的容器,一个进程可以包含多个线程,进程是资源分配的基本单位。
线程是属于某个进程,并跟进程中的其他线程共享该进程的资源。同一进程中的线程可以共享相同的内存地址空间,同时每个线程还拥有自己单独的栈内存。
线程是程序执行的最小单位,也是操作系统调度和分配CPU的最小单位,是进程中的一个实体,是进程中实际运行的单位。可以在进程中启动多个线程来完成不同的任务,这些线程共享该进程拥有的资源。
进程是程序的实体,也是线程的容器,一个进程可以包含多个线程,进程是资源分配的基本单位。
线程是属于某个进程,并跟进程中的其他线程共享该进程的资源。同一进程中的线程可以共享相同的内存地址空间,同时每个线程还拥有自己单独的栈内存。